B. ACTION ITEM. DR-2023-11-MOD1 — Modification to the Common Area Landscaping
and Amenities within Kingswood Estates Subdivision — TBC Land Holdings LLC: TBC
Land Holdings LLC, is requesting design review approval to modify the common area
landscaping and amenities within Kingswood Estates Subdivision. The 38.81-acre site is
located on the west side of North Linder Road approximately 1,430-feet north of the
intersection of North Linder Road and West Floating Feather Road. (ERF)
Dean Waite, TBC Land Holdings, 2154 E. Timber Trail, provides an overview of the
application and responds to questions from the Board.
City Planner, Emily Falco, provides an overview of the application and responds to questions
from Board.
Jim Mihan, 2002 S. Vista, Boise, responds to questions from the Board.
Glenn Walker, 1831 E. Overland, addresses the Board's concern regarding the pool house
structure massing and materials.
Lindgren moves to approve DR-2023-11-MOD1 — Modification to the Common Area
Landscaping and Amenities within Kingswood Estates Subdivision as presented with the
following site specific conditions.
Site specific: #3: Condition to remain. Encourage applicant to come back with a
decorative wall that meets the criteria in site specific condition #3 and giving the
applicant some latitude to provide alternate stone material if that is their desire. In
general, we are comfortable with the 4' berm and 6' wall. To be reviewed by staff and
two members of the Design Review Board.
Site specific #13: Applicant to provide colored elevations more specifically highlighting
materials and color selections specific to the building that will help state what is being
proposed from a materials standpoint. To be reviewed by staff and two members of the
Design Review Board.
Site specific #14: Applicant to consider breaking that center massing plane where the
change of material, change of roof height, everything else changes of the center massing
at the front and rear of the building would break those plains horizontally. To be
reviewed by staff and two members of the Design Review Board.
Site specific #15: Applicant to reconsider the positioning of the upper windows on both
the pool side and entry side as they relate to one and another. Also, reconsider having
those windows to bring in natural light into that center area. To see if that upper truss
could be brought up above that area. These are just recommendations, but highly
recommended if could be achieved. To be reviewed by staff and two members of the
Design Review Board.
Seconded by Grubb.
Discussion.
Lindgren amends his motion to add to site specific #13: Will include all structures.
Seconded by Grubb. All AYES...MOTION CARRIES.
C. ACTION ITEM. DR-2024-38 - Two Subdivision Entry Monument Signs for Kingswood
Estates Subdivision — TBC Land Holdings LLC: TBC Land Holdings, LLC, represented by
Terry Brown with Lytle Signs, is requesting design review approval for two halo illuminated
subdivision entry monument signs for Kingswood Estates Subdivision. The 38.81-acre site is
located on the west side of North Linder Road approximately 1,430-feet north of the
intersection of North Linder Road and West Floating Feather Road. (ERF)
Dean Waite, 2154 E. Timer Trail, provides an overview of the application and responds to
questions from the Board.
City Planner, Emily Falco provides an overview of the application.
Lindgren moves to approve DR-2024-38 - Two Subdivision Entry Monument Signs for
Kingswood Estates Subdivision as presented with the site specific conditions with the
following modifications.
Add Site Specific Condition #6: Provide lighting cutsheets showing the lighting not to
exceed 3000 Kelvin. To be reviewed by staff and one member of the Design Review
Board.
Add Site Specific Condition #7: The stone veneer for the sign along Linder should
complement the stone on the wall on the top of the berm. To be reviewed by staff and one
member of the Design Review Board.
Seconded by Greer. ALL AYES...MOTION CARRIES.
